Команда /EXPORT обеспечивает пакетный экспорт сообщений электронной почты The Bat! из определенной папки в несколько файлов стандарта RFC822 или в почтовые ящики UNIX. 

Синтаксис команды /EXPORT:

/EXPORT:[parameter1[;parameter2[;parameter3 […]]]

Возможные параметры:

  • USER=значение или U=значение.

Значение – название ящика, из которого будет произведен экспорт. Если параметр FOLDER не определен, сообщения будут экспортированы из папки «Inbox» («Входящие») данного ящика.

  • PASSWORD=значение или P=значение.

Значение – пароль. Используется в том случае, если ящик защищен па ролем.

  • FOLDER=значение или F=значение.

Значение – путь к папке в ящике, из которой нужно экспортировать сообщения. Если путь не включает имя ящика, The Bat! будет просматривать все ящики в поисках папки с таким именем; из первой найденной папки будут экспортироваться сообщения. Если заданная папка не найдена, сообщения будут экспортированы из папки «Inbox» («Входящие») указанного ящика.

  • DIR=значение или D=значение или OUT=значение или O=значение.

Значение – путь к каталогу экспорта (для RFC882 сообщений) или к выходному файлу (для почтового ящика UNIX). Если выбран формат RFC822, экс портируемые сообщения сохраняются в каталоге экспорта в файлах с имена ми xxxxxxxx.MSG (каждый символ «x» соответствует цифре от 0 до 9). Когда начинается экспорт, The Bat! вычисляет начальный xxxxxxxx номер путем поиска в каталоге экспорта файлов с именами в том же самом формате и, в случае если такие файлы найдены, имя первого выходного файла представляет собой число, большее, чем максимальное найденное имя. Например, если файл 00001234.MSG был найден в каталоге экспорта, первое экспортируемое сообщение будет помещено в файл с именем 00001235.MSG.

  • UNIX или X.

Этот параметр сообщает программе The Bat!, что выходные файлы должны быть в формате почтового ящика UNIX. В этом случае параметр DIR определя ет имя выходного файла. По умолчанию, выходные файлы создаются в стан дарте RFC822.

  • READ или R.

Когда используется этот параметр, будут экспортированы только прочитанные сообщения. По умолчанию, экспортируются все сообщения.

  • UNREAD или N.

Когда используется этот параметр, будут экспортированы только непрочитанные сообщения.

  • MAXAGE=значение или AGE=значение, или A=значение.

Значение определяет максимальный срок хранения (в днях) экспортируе мыхсообщений. Если срок хранения сообщения превышает определенный максимальный срок, сообщение не будет экспортировано. По умолчанию максимальный срок не ограничен.

  • START=значение или S=значение.

Значение определяет номер начального сообщения в исходной папке. Все сообщения, расположенные перед начальным сообщением, не будут экспортированы. Если задано отрицательное значение, номер начального сообщения вычисляется вычитанием положительной величины значения из числа сообщений в папке, например, если задано число –5, это означает, что экспорт начнется с пятого сообщения с конца базы сообщений.

  • END=значение или E=значение.

Значение определяет номер конечного сообщения в исходной папке. Все сообщения, расположенные после конечного сообщения, не будут экспортированы. Если задано отрицательное значение, номер конечного сообщения вычисляется вычитанием положительной величины значения из числа сообщений в папке, например, если задано число –2, это означает, что экспорт закончится на втором сообщении с конца базы сообщений.

  • OVERRIDE или V (только когда задан параметр UNIX)

Если задан этот параметр, The Bat! перезапишет выходной файл в случае, если он существует. По умолчанию, The Bat! добавляет новые сообщения к концу файла почтового ящика.

  • LDIF для работы с адресной книгой. Используйте параметр «B» для выбора адресной книги и параметр «G» для выбора группы. Пример в /IMPORT.

Примеры команды /EXPORT:

/EXPORTU=»Мой ящик 1″;F=»Друзья и знакомые\Sam»;DIR=C:\InFiles\Sam\; S=-20 /EXPORTF=»\\Ящик1\Business\Unsorted»;UNIX;O=C:\infiles\ unsorted\mail.mbx;UNREAD

Примечание

Для разделения параметров используйте точку с запятой (символ «;»). Не используйте пробелы между параметрами, когда используете команду /EXPORT в командной строке, потому что отделенный пробелом параметр будет обра батываться как следующая команда и не будет понят программой должным образом. Если значение содержит пробелы, поместите его в кавычки. Если значение со держит кавычки, вы должны использовать апострофы (символ «“»).